Join us for an immersive workshop on portrait photography, where we will explore the art of capturing human expression, identity, and storytelling through the lens. This hands-on session is designed for photographers of all levels who want to refine their skills in lighting, composition, and directing subjects to create compelling and meaningful portraits.
What You’ll Learn:
* Understanding natural and artificial lighting for portraits
* Composition techniques to enhance storytelling
* Directing and engaging with subjects to capture authentic emotions
* The importance of imperfections and raw moments in portraiture
Through practical exercises, live demonstrations, and constructive feedback, participants will develop a deeper understanding of how to create striking portraits that go beyond aesthetics to convey emotion and narrative. Whether you are interested in editorial, documentary, or fine art portraiture, this workshop will equip you with the tools to bring your vision to life.
@yasminahilal_ received her BA in Visual Media Arts, with a minor in Photography, from Emerson College. While there, she experimented heavily in the dark room, observing alternative techniques to scanning, printing, and manipulating images.
The result is a body of work that asks the viewer to linger a little longer and move through aspects of the piece. Like a snake, her art moves through visual and emotional landscapes that are both variable and static.
Yasmina Hilal has exhibited her works in group exhibitions, including A Complex Embodiment (Los Angeles, 2021), The Chemistry of Feeling (Dubai, 2021), The Cutting Studios Annual Exhibition (Doha, 2022), Dear Moon (Beirut, 2022), Solo Exhibition: I See Me In You at MENA Art Fair (Brussels, 2023), The Age of Dystopia at Dalloul Art Foundation (Beirut, 2024), and The Material Woman at Soho Revue (London, 2024).
